Job Description
Our Consulting Line of Business spans 29 countries across EMEA, working across six major markets within our four main solution areas: Organizational Strategy, Total Reward, Leadership & Development, and Assessment & Succession.
The Principal
The Principal plays a senior role within Korn Ferry Consulting, accountable for leading complex, multi-workstream engagements and ensuring consistently high-quality delivery for UK&I clients.
While many current programmes sit within Assessment & Succession and Leadership & Professional Development, this role is solution-agnostic. The emphasis is on engagement leadership, programme governance, and client delivery excellence, rather than deep specialism in a single solution area.
Role Overview
As a Principal, you will play a critical leadership role in Korn Ferry Consulting—accountable for leading complex client engagements, shaping solutions, and delivering measurable commercial outcomes.
You will operate across solution areas, bringing together Korn Ferry’s full capabilities to design and deliver integrated solutions to client challenges. This role requires a balanced focus across delivery leadership and commercial contribution, with primary accountability anchored in successful engagement outcomes.
Principals act as trusted advisors to senior clients, lead high-performing teams, and take ownership of delivery quality, impact, and profitability across their engagements. They operate within broader account teams, contributing to growth and client strategy without default ownership of accounts.

Key Responsibilities
Engagement Leadership & Delivery
- Own the delivery of large, complex, multi-workstream engagements, with clear accountability for outcomes, quality, and commercial performance
- Design and maintain clear programme governance, structure, and delivery cadence
- Act as a senior escalation point, proactively managing risk, dependencies, and delivery challenges
- Ensure engagement delivery aligns to client outcomes, quality standards, and commercial commitments
Client Leadership & Relationship Management
- Build and sustain trusted relationships with senior client stakeholders.
- Lead key client meetings and forums focused on delivery progress, risks, and decision-making.
- Shape client thinking by bringing insight, challenge, and integrated perspectives
- Manage stakeholder expectations across complex, multi-workstream delivery environments
- Represent Korn Ferry with credibility and confidence in complex client environments.
Commercial & Financial Ownership
- Own engagement financials, including forecasting, revenue recognition, billing, and margin.
- Proactively manage scope changes and commercial risks.
- Balance delivery excellence with commercial outcomes and profitability
- Identify and support follow-on and cross-solution opportunities through delivery insight
- Lead or support proposal development, pricing, and commercial structuring
Team Leadership & Capability Building
- Matrix-lead and coordinate diverse high-performing delivery teams across Korn Ferry solutions.
- Coach and develop junior consultants, fostering growth, accountability, and inclusion.
- Provide quality assurance and oversight across engagement deliverables.
- Contribute to the development of delivery capability and consulting excellence across the firm.
Continuous Improvement & Firm Contribution
- Contribute to the development of delivery best practices and engagement management capability.
- Share learning and insights across the Consulting community.
- Contribute to thought leadership, propositions, and go-to-market initiatives
- Support market-facing activity (e.g. client events, publications, industry engagement)
- Support internal initiatives aimed at improving delivery excellence and client experience.

Skills And Competencies
- Advanced engagement management capability – Proven ability to lead large, complex programmes with structure and accountability.
- Strong client leadership skills – Credible and confident with senior stakeholders.
- Commercial acumen – Comfortable owning financial performance and managing risk.
- Structured problem-solving – Brings clarity and rigour to complex delivery environments.
- Inclusive leadership style – Builds trust, collaboration, and accountability.
- Resilience and adaptability – Thrives in fast-paced, ambiguous contexts.
- Technology literate – Fluent in Microsoft Office and comfortable using AI-enabled tools (e.g. Copilot, ChatGPT).
Experience & Qualifications
- Significant experience leading the delivery of complex consulting or professional services engagements.
- Proven track record of managing multi-disciplinary, matrixed teams.
- Experience owning engagement financials and commercial outcomes.
- Strong understanding of programme and project management disciplines.
- Bachelor’s degree or equivalent professional experience.
